Why Choose a Persian Cat?

Persian cats are known for their luxurious long fur, sweet temperament, and affectionate nature. They make excellent companions and are ideal for families or individuals looking for a loving pet. Their calm demeanor makes them suitable for indoor living, and they thrive on human interaction.

How to Care for Your Persian Cat

Caring for a Persian cat involves regular grooming due to their long fur, which can mat easily. It's essential to brush them daily to keep their coat healthy and free of tangles. Additionally, regular vet check-ups, a balanced diet, and plenty of playtime will ensure your Persian remains happy and healthy.

What is the average price of a Persian cat?

The price of a Persian cat typically ranges from $500 to $2,000 depending on factors such as pedigree, age, and breeder reputation.

Are Persian cats good with children?

Yes, Persian cats are generally gentle and affectionate, making them great companions for children. However, supervision is recommended during playtime.

How often should I groom my Persian cat?

It's advisable to groom your Persian cat daily to prevent matting and keep their coat healthy.

Understanding the Persian Cat Breed

Key Characteristics

  • Appearance: Long, flowing coat, round face, large expressive eyes, and a short nose.
  • Temperament: Gentle, affectionate, and calm. They enjoy lounging and are great companions.
  • Care Needs: Regular grooming, eye cleaning, and health check-ups.

Common Health Concerns

  • Respiratory issues: Due to their flat faces.
  • Eye problems: Such as tear staining.
  • Skin and coat: Requires frequent grooming to prevent matting.

Adoption vs. Buying: Pros and Cons

AspectAdoptionBuying from Breeder/Pet Store
CostUsually lower; adoption fees often include vaccinations and spaying/neuteringCan be higher; price varies based on pedigree and breeder reputation
Health & GeneticsOlder cats may have unknown health history; some may have pre-existing conditionsUsually healthier with documented lineage, but requires verification
Ethical ConsiderationsSaving a life and giving a home to a rescueSupporting responsible breeding practices
SelectionLimited to available cats in shelters or rescue groupsWide selection of ages, colors, and pedigrees
Emotional ImpactHighly rewarding to rescue a cat in needExciting to select a specific kitten with desired traits

Price Drivers for Persian Cats

FactorImpact on Price
AgeKittens are generally more expensive than adult cats
Color & PatternRare colors or patterns may command higher prices
Pedigree & LineageWell-documented pedigrees increase cost
Health & VaccinationFully vaccinated and health-checked cats cost more
LocationPrices vary by region and local demand

Checklist Before Bringing a Persian Cat Home

  • Confirm health records and vaccinations.
  • Prepare a safe, comfortable space.
  • Gather grooming supplies.
  • Schedule a veterinary check-up.
  • Research dietary needs.
  • Understand grooming routines.
